Take it slow, be very cautious and safe....once something is done that terrifies them of the water, you will be fighting a battle for the rest of that babys life! I had a "groomer" (supposed to be one of the best in the area) almost drown one of my babies by passing him all up under a faucet, water in nose, eyes, ears, mouth, he came home that day absolutely terrified of water and bathing and he NEVER got over that terror....he lived another 8 years and he was absolutely terrified of water from that day forward.

Your baby is only 8 weeks old? There is no rush in getting this baby acclimated to a pool....certainly not before totally vaccinated....take your time, go slow and easy, because once you screw it up for the baby and baby is terrified of water, she will live with that fear....
